[1] This is a summary application in which the pursuer ("the AIB ") seeks an order pursuant to section 29(6) of the Bankruptcy ( Scotland ) Act 1985 ("the 1985 Act") that the office of trustee has become vacant and for certain other orders. The action is undefended but an issue of competency has arisen. I put the matter out for a hearing and had the benefit of being addressed by Mr Lloyd on behalf of the AIB .
[2] The defender was sequestrated on his own application to the AIB on 29 th April 2008 . The AIB was the trustee in sequestration. Both the pursuer and the defender have been discharged respectively. It has now come to light that there are assets by way of a claim that the defender had against a third party. The pursuer was unaware of this claim. There are monies available. The problem is that, having been discharged, there is no trustee in office to deal with this matter.
[3] The issue is not a new one and is well set out in paragraphs 8-75 to 8-76 of McBryde on Bankruptcy (2 nd edition) (" McBryde "):-
